Japan
Facts and Figures
Source: CIA World Factbook |
| Coordinates |
36 00 N, 138 00 E |
| Area |
total: 377,835 sq km land: 374,744 sq km water: 3,091 sq km note: includes Bonin Islands (Ogasawara-gunto), Daito-shoto, Minami-jima, Okino-tori-shima, Ryukyu Islands (Nansei-shoto), and Volcano Islands (Kazan-retto) |
| Climate |
varies from tropical in south to cool temperate in north |
| Terrain |
mostly rugged and mountainous |
| Population |
127,433,494 (July 2007 est.) |
| Languages |
Japanese |
| Imports |
machinery and equipment, fuels, foodstuffs, chemicals, textiles, raw materials |
| Exports |
transport equipment, motor vehicles, semiconductors, electrical machinery, chemicals |
| Hazards |
many dormant and some active volcanoes; about 1,500 seismic occurrences (mostly tremors) every year; tsunamis; typhoons |
| Resources |
negligible mineral resources, fish |
| Geography |
strategic location in northeast Asia |
| Nationality |
noun: Japanese (singular and plural) adjective: Japanese |
| Capital |
name: Tokyo geographic coordinates: 35 42 N, 139 46 E time difference: UTC+9 (14 hours ahead of Washington, DC during Standard Time) |
| Internet Country Code |
.jp |
| Internet Users |
86.3 million (2005) |
